+# Set initial variables:
+
+PRGNAM=fbreader
+VERSION=${VERSION:-0.12.10}
+BUILD=${BUILD:-1}
+TAG=${TAG:-alien}
+
+DOCS="CHANGES* README* fbreader/LICENSE fbreader/VERSION"
+
+# Where do we look for sources?
+SRCDIR=$(cd $(dirname $0); pwd)
+
+# Place to build (TMP) package (PKG) and output (OUTPUT) the program:
+TMP=${TMP:-/tmp/build}
+PKG=$TMP/package-$PRGNAM
+OUTPUT=${OUTPUT:-/tmp}
+
+# Input URL: http://fbreader.org/fbreader-sources-0.12.10.tgz
+SOURCE="$SRCDIR/${PRGNAM}-${VERSION}.tgz"
+SRCURL="http://fbreader.org/${PRGNAM}-sources-${VERSION}.tgz"
+
+##
+## --- with a little luck, you won't have to edit below this point --- ##
+##
+
+# Automatically determine the architecture we're building on:
+if [ -z "$ARCH" ]; then
+ case "$( uname -m )" in
+ i?86) export ARCH=i486 ;;
+ arm*) export ARCH=arm ;;
+ # Unless $ARCH is already set, use uname -m for all other archs:
+ *) export ARCH=$( uname -m ) ;;
+ esac
+fi
+
+case "$ARCH" in
+ i486) SLKCFLAGS="-O2 -march=i486 -mtune=i686"
+ SLKLDFLAGS=""; LIBDIRSUFFIX=""
+ ;;
+ x86_64) SLKCFLAGS="-O2 -fPIC"
+ SLKLDFLAGS="-L/usr/lib64"; LIBDIRSUFFIX="64"
+ ;;
+ *) SLKCFLAGS="-O2"
+ SLKLDFLAGS=""; LIBDIRSUFFIX=""
+ ;;
+esac
+
+# Exit the script on errors:
+set -e
+trap 'echo "$0 FAILED at line ${LINENO}" | tee $OUTPUT/error-${PRGNAM}.log' ERR
+# Catch unitialized variables:
+set -u
+P1=${1:-1}
+
+# Save old umask and set to 0022:
+_UMASK_=$(umask)
+umask 0022
+
+# Create working directories:
+mkdir -p $OUTPUT # place for the package to be saved
+mkdir -p $TMP/tmp-$PRGNAM # location to build the source
+mkdir -p $PKG # place for the package to be built
+rm -rf $PKG/* # always erase old package's contents
+rm -rf $TMP/tmp-$PRGNAM/* # remove the remnants of previous build
+rm -rf $OUTPUT/{configure,make,install,error,makepkg}-$PRGNAM.log
+ # remove old log files
+
+# Source file availability:
+if ! [ -f ${SOURCE} ]; then
+ echo "Source '$(basename ${SOURCE})' not available yet..."
+ # Check if the $SRCDIR is writable at all - if not, download to $OUTPUT
+ [ -w "$SRCDIR" ] || SOURCE="$OUTPUT/$(basename $SOURCE)"
+ if [ -f ${SOURCE} ]; then echo "Ah, found it!"; continue; fi
+ if ! [ "x${SRCURL}" == "x" ]; then
+ echo "Will download file to $(dirname $SOURCE)"
+ wget -nv -T 20 -O "${SOURCE}" "${SRCURL}" || true
+ if [ $? -ne 0 -o ! -s "${SOURCE}" ]; then
+ echo "Downloading '$(basename ${SOURCE})' failed... aborting the build."
+ mv -f "${SOURCE}" "${SOURCE}".FAIL
+ exit 1
+ fi
+ else
+ echo "File '$(basename ${SOURCE})' not available... aborting the build."
+ exit 1
+ fi
+fi
+
+if [ "$P1" == "--download" ]; then
+ echo "Download complete."
+ exit 0
+fi
+
+# --- PACKAGE BUILDING ---
+
+echo "++"
+echo "|| $PRGNAM-$VERSION"
+echo "++"
+
+cd $TMP/tmp-$PRGNAM
+echo "Extracting the source archive(s) for $PRGNAM..."
+tar -xvf ${SOURCE}
+cd ${PRGNAM}-${VERSION}
+
+# Fix wrong moc filename:
+sed -i -e "s#moc-qt4#moc#" makefiles/arch/desktop.mk
+
+# Fix the Qt4 related stuff (thanks to the script at SlackBuilds.org for this):
+sed -i -e "s#CFLAGS =#CFLAGS = $SLKCFLAGS#" makefiles/arch/desktop.mk
+sed -i -e 's#-I /usr/include/qt4#$(shell pkg-config --cflags QtGui)#' makefiles/arch/desktop.mk
+sed -i -e 's#-lQtGui#$(shell pkg-config --libs QtGui)#' makefiles/arch/desktop.mk
+
+chown -R root:root .
+chmod -R u+w,go+r-w,a+X-s .
+
+echo Building ...
+export LDFLAGS="$SLKLDFLAGS"
+export CXXFLAGS="$SLKCFLAGS"
+export CFLAGS="$SLKCFLAGS"
+
+make \
+ INSTALLDIR=/usr LIBDIR=/usr/lib${LIBDIRSUFFIX} \
+ TARGET_ARCH="desktop" UI_TYPE=${UITYPE} \
+ 2>&1 | tee $OUTPUT/make-${PRGNAM}.log
+make DESTDIR=$PKG install \
+ INSTALLDIR=/usr LIBDIR=/usr/lib${LIBDIRSUFFIX} \
+ TARGET_ARCH="desktop" UI_TYPE=${UITYPE} \
+ 2>&1 | tee $OUTPUT/install-${PRGNAM}.log
+
+# Add this to the doinst.sh:
+mkdir -p $PKG/install
+cat <<EOINS >> $PKG/install/doinst.sh
+# Update the desktop database:
+if [ -x usr/bin/update-desktop-database ]; then
+ chroot . /usr/bin/update-desktop-database usr/share/applications > /dev/null 2>&1
+fi
+
+# Update hicolor theme cache:
+if [ -d usr/share/icons/hicolor ]; then
+ if [ -x /usr/bin/gtk-update-icon-cache ]; then
+ chroot . /usr/bin/gtk-update-icon-cache -f -t usr/share/icons/hicolor 1> /dev/null 2> /dev/null
+ fi
+fi
+
+# Update the mime database:
+if [ -x usr/bin/update-mime-database ]; then
+ chroot . /usr/bin/update-mime-database usr/share/mime >/dev/null 2>&1
+fi
+
+EOINS
+
+# Add documentation:
+mkdir -p $PKG/usr/doc/$PRGNAM-$VERSION
+cp -a $DOCS $PKG/usr/doc/$PRGNAM-$VERSION || true
+cat $SRCDIR/$(basename $0) > $PKG/usr/doc/$PRGNAM-$VERSION/$PRGNAM.SlackBuild
+chown -R root:root $PKG/usr/doc/$PRGNAM-$VERSION
+find $PKG/usr/doc -type f -exec chmod 644 {} \;
+
+# Compress the man page(s):
+if [ -d $PKG/usr/man ]; then
+ find $PKG/usr/man -type f -name "*.?" -exec gzip -9f {} \;
+ for i in $(find $PKG/usr/man -type l -name "*.?") ; do ln -s $( readlink $i ).gz $i.gz ; rm $i ; done
+fi
+
+# Strip binaries (if any):
+find $PKG | xargs file | grep -e "executable" -e "shared object" | grep ELF \
+ | cut -f 1 -d : | xargs strip --strip-unneeded 2> /dev/null || true
+
+# Add a package description:
+mkdir -p $PKG/install
+cat $SRCDIR/slack-desc > $PKG/install/slack-desc
+
+# Build the package:
+cd $PKG
+makepkg --linkadd y --chown n $OUTPUT/${PRGNAM}-${VERSION}-${ARCH}-${BUILD}${TAG}.${PKGTYPE:-tgz} 2>&1 | tee $OUTPUT/makepkg-${PRGNAM}.log
+cd $OUTPUT
+md5sum ${PRGNAM}-${VERSION}-${ARCH}-${BUILD}${TAG}.${PKGTYPE:-tgz} > ${PRGNAM}-${VERSION}-${ARCH}-${BUILD}${TAG}.${PKGTYPE:-tgz}.md5
+cd -
+cat $PKG/install/slack-desc | grep "^${PRGNAM}" > $OUTPUT/${PRGNAM}-${VERSION}-${ARCH}-${BUILD}${TAG}.txt
+
+# Restore the original umask:
+umask ${_UMASK_}

+# HOW TO EDIT THIS FILE:
+# The "handy ruler" below makes it easier to edit a package description. Line
+# up the first '|' above the ':' following the base package name, and the '|'
+# on the right side marks the last column you can put a character in. You must
+# make exactly 11 lines for the formatting to be correct. It's also
+# customary to leave one space after the ':'.
+
+ |-----handy-ruler------------------------------------------------------|
+fbreader: fbreader (e-book reader)
+fbreader:
+fbreader: FBReader is an e-book reader for various platforms.
+fbreader: Supported formats include: fb2, HTML, chm, plucker, palmdoc, zTxt,
+fbreader: TCR, RTF, OEB, OpenReader, mobipocket, plain text.
